Description

BillingPlatform is looking for a skilled Database Administrator (DBA) with a strong background in Oracle and a proactive, solutions-driven mindset. This role requires someone with excellent problem-solving abilities who can quickly analyze systems, troubleshoot functionality, and implement effective solutions. Key responsibilities include designing and developing new features, reviewing and optimizing existing code, and executing proposed improvements to enhance system performance.


Responsibilities:

  • Build database systems of high availability and quality depending on each end user’s specialized role
  • Design and implement database in accordance to end users' information needs and views
  • Use high-speed transaction recovery techniques and backup data
  • Minimize database downtime and manage parameters to provide fast query responses
  • Provide proactive and reactive data management support and training to users
  • Determine, enforce, and document database policies, procedures, and standards
  • Perform tests and evaluations regularly to ensure data security, privacy, and integrity
  • Monitor database performance, implement changes, and apply new patches and versions when required
  • Proven working experience as a DBA
  • Hands-on experience with database standards and end-user applications
  • Excellent knowledge of data backup, recovery, security, integrity, and SQL
  • Familiarity with database design, documentation, and coding
  • Previous experience with DBA case tools (frontend/backend) and third-party tools
  • Problem-solving skills and ability to think algorithmically


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science or a related field
  • Oracle certifications preferred
  • Experience with Linux and Windows Server environments
  • Extensive experience with database technologies (MySQL, MS SQL, PostgreSQL Oracle, MongoDB)
  • Experience with cloud services (AWS, Microsoft Azure) a plus
